Rangers vs Lightning: Last 10 Games Head-to-Head Record & Stats

Rangers fans have been closely tracking how their team performs under stormy conditions, and StatMuse data for the last 10 games provides clarity. This set of Rangers vs Lightning record last 10 games StatMuse stats highlights trends in scoring, goaltending, and special teams, giving a clear view of recent matchups.

By examining the Rangers versus Lightning last 10 games StatMuse records, we can spot which team generates higher danger chances and controls pace. Below is a structured summary of the key outcomes from that period.

Metric Rangers Lightning Edge
Goals For per Game 3.2 3.6 Lightning
Goals Against per Game 2.8 3.1 Rangers
Power Play % 22.4 26.7 Lightning
Shots on Goal (per game) 31.7 33.2 Lightning
Close Games (1-goal) 4 4 Even

Rangers Offensive Production vs Lightning

In head-to-head contests over the last 10 games, the Rangers averaged 3.2 goals per night while facing a stingy defense. Their offense generated structure from the perimeter and capitalized on half-chances, but struggled to sustain pressure over entire shifts. Lightning forwards responded with a slightly higher goals-for average, benefiting from dynamic play in the neutral zone and timely snapshots in tight situations.

Goaltending and Defensive Metrics

Rangers goaltending showed a lower goals against average at 2.8, indicating stronger individual performance in key frames. Shot suppression and rebound control were notable strengths, allowing fewer high-danger attempts compared to league average. Lightning netminders posted a modestly higher 3.1 goals against number but faced a higher volume of shots, reflecting sustained offensive pressure from opposing teams overall.

Power play efficiency heavily influenced the edge in these matchups, with Lightning converting at 26.7% compared to Rangers 22.4%. On the man advantage, Lightning generated more traffic in front and better cross ice passing options. Penalties were relatively balanced, yet special teams outcomes frequently dictated momentum shifts and final scores in these ten games recorded by StatMuse.

Game Flow and Close Contest Frequency

Four of the ten games were decided by a single goal, underscoring how evenly matched these teams have been recently. Tight games produced fewer total shots, yet high intensity from both rosters kept pressure elevated. Tactical adjustments between periods often determined whether a team could close strong or protect a lead late in the third frame.
